Frequently Asked Questions about Sunnyvale

How much are Studio apartments in Sunnyvale?

There are currently 135 Studio Apartments in Sunnyvale with rent ranges from $1,250 to $10,000 with an average price of $3,168.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Sunnyvale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Sunnyvale ranges from $1,150 to $12,771 with an average monthly rent of $3,619.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Sunnyvale c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Sunnyvale range from $2,392 to $15,491.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,644.

How expensive are Sunnyvale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 492 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Sunnyvale on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,150 to $13,952 - averaging $5,217 for the location.
